Rethinking Nonprofits
Brewster discusses the potential of nonprofits as a force for public good, likening them to secular churches with mission-oriented goals. He advocates for a new generation of organizations that prioritize transparency and community benefit over profit, drawing inspiration from successful open source initiatives like Wikipedia and the Internet Archive.
